No. It is not. For me, it is essential to know all the info it gives to you, orbit info, surface, delta-v stats... And unlike KER, it gives you the chance of executing manouver nodes. I still make my own manouver nodes, but I let MJ to execute them, as it's precision is often needed to achieve the orbits I intend to when a 4 m/s difference can really ruin your day. And of course, when you have to launch for the seventh time a rocket you've tested already, to an orbit you've put it already, many times before, making it automatic is just great. -
